Hallo Sven,
Blödsinn, so sollte es sein:
switch($count)
{
case 2:
$temp = ' <a href="index.php">'.$link.'</a> ';
echo $temp." » ".$title;
break;
case 3:
$temp =' <a href="index.php">'.$link.'</a> ';
$path = strtoupper($intermediate[1]);
echo $temp." » ".$path." » ".$title;
break;
case 4:
$temp = ' <a href="index.php">'.$link.'</a> ';
$path = strtoupper($intermediate[1]);
$subpath = strtoupper($intermediate[2]);
echo $temp." » ".$path." » ".$subpath." » ".$title;
break;
}
Der typische "off by one"-Fehler. War ja klar, ich baue gerne Fehler ein, die absolut unscheinbar sind. Aber du warst gewarnt. :)
Ja, wobei mich die Zählweise von count() nun doch etwas überrascht hat und ich einige Zeit brauchte, um auf die Lösung zu kommen. ;-)
Die Logik dahinter ist mir nicht ganz klar.
Danke dir!
Gruß
Kurt
"Es geht nicht darum, ob es Gott gibt; es geht darum, an Gott zu glauben. Nicht Gottes wegen, sondern des Glaubens wegen." (Moriartes, gr. Philosoph, 314-244 v. Chr.)
http://elektro-dunzinger.at
http://shop.elektro-dunzinger.at